Number Adventures for Young Learners

Young learners blossom best when introduced to new concepts through interactive activities. Numbers, a fundamental building block of mathematics, can be presented in a captivating manner through creative games. Number assembly games spark a read more love for numbers by allowing children to construct numerical pieces to form compelling patterns. These games not only enhance number recognition and understanding but also cultivate essential skills like problem-solving, critical thinking, and spatial reasoning.

By incorporating playful elements into learning, these games transform math from a chore.

  • Foster creativity through open-ended number assembly challenges.
  • Offer various materials like blocks, tiles, or even everyday objects to support construction.
  • Set clear goals and aims to guide children's exploration while allowing for flexibility.

Through these engaging number assembly games, young learners can embark on a rewarding journey into the world of numbers.
